Remodeling a Bathroom in Henderson
Henderson has some of the youngest housing of any major U.S. city — its median home was built in 2001, per the U.S. Census Bureau — thanks to master-planned communities like Green Valley, Anthem and Inspirada. Remodels here are rarely about failing systems; they're about turning circa-2000 builder bathrooms (beige tile, framed brass-trimmed glass, garden tubs) into modern, low-maintenance spaces, and about aging-in-place upgrades for the city's many retirees.
Henderson shares the Las Vegas Valley's "very hard" water — the regional supply measures around 280 ppm (16 grains per gallon), per the Las Vegas Valley Water District — so softeners and scale-resistant finishes are smart additions. The City of Henderson issues its own building permits, and every permit-level project requires a Nevada State Contractors Board-licensed contractor.

Bathroom Remodeling in Henderson: FAQ
What are the most common bathroom remodel projects in Henderson?
Updating circa-2000 builder bathrooms (Henderson's median home dates to 2001) and accessibility work: curbless showers, grab-bar blocking and comfort-height fixtures. For full accessibility, walk-in tubs average about $13,100 installed per HomeAdvisor's 2025 data, while tub-to-shower conversions average around $3,000 per Angi.
Does Henderson have the same hard water as Las Vegas?
Yes — the valley's shared supply is categorized "very hard" at roughly 280 ppm (16 grains per gallon) per the Las Vegas Valley Water District. Plan on a softener or diligent scale management to protect new fixtures and glass.
Who issues bathroom remodel permits in Henderson?
The City of Henderson's building department handles permits inside city limits, and Nevada law requires an NSCB-licensed contractor for any permit-level work. Verify the license classification and status in the Contractors Board's official search before signing.
